Effects of Sleep Deprivation on Cognitive Performance: Experimental Design Analysis

Hard Research Design And Analysis Experimental Design

In a study examining the effects of sleep deprivation on cognitive performance, researchers randomly assigned participants to either a sleep-deprivation group or a control group that received a full night's rest. The participants were then given a series of cognitive tasks to assess memory recall, problem-solving skills, and reaction times. Based on this scenario, answer the following questions:

1. Identify the independent and dependent variables in this study.

2. Discuss how random assignment contributes to the internal validity of the experiment.

3. Propose a potential confounding variable in this study and explain how it could impact the results.

4. Suggest a method for mitigating the impact of the identified confounding variable on the findings of the study.
